HTML DOM Input Radio required Property
I denne artikel vil vi dykke ned i HTML DOM Input Radio required Property og hvordan det kan bruges til at validere radio buttons i HTML-formularer. Vi vil udforske de forskellige egenskaber og metoder i denne DOM-egenskab og give dig en grundig forståelse af, hvordan du kan implementere det i dine projekter.
Introduktion til HTML DOM Input Radio required Property
HTML DOM Input Radio required Property er en egenskab, der kan tilføjes til radio buttons i HTML-formularer for at angive, om feltet er obligatorisk eller ej. Når denne egenskab er angivet til true, betyder det, at mindst én af radio buttonsne i gruppen skal være markeret, før formularen kan sendes.
Denne egenskab kan være nyttig i formularer, hvor brugerne skal vælge ét eller flere valgmuligheder fra en liste af radio buttons. Ved at gøre feltet obligatorisk kan du sikre, at brugerne ikke kan sende formularen, medmindre de har valgt mindst én option.
Anvendelse af HTML DOM Input Radio required Property
For at angive, at et radio button-felt er obligatorisk, skal du tilføje attributten required til input-elementet i HTML-koden. Her er et eksempel:
I dette eksempel er radio button-feltet markeret som obligatorisk ved hjælp af attributten required. Dette betyder, at mindst én radio button i gruppen med navnet options skal være markeret, før formularen kan sendes.
Validering af HTML DOM Input Radio required Property
Når brugeren forsøger at sende formularen, vil browseren validere, om mindst én radio button i gruppen er markeret. Hvis ingen radio buttons er markeret, vil browseren vise en fejlmeddelelse og forhindre formularen i at blive sendt.
Du kan tilpasse fejlmeddelelsen ved at tilføje attributten title til input-elementet. Her er et eksempel:
I dette eksempel vil fejlmeddelelsen Vælg mindst én option blive vist, hvis brugeren forsøger at sende formularen uden at vælge denne specifikke option.
DOM-metoder til HTML DOM Input Radio required Property
HTML DOM Input Radio required Property giver også nogle nyttige metoder til at arbejde med radio buttons. Her er et par eksempler:
- checkValidity() – Denne metode kan bruges til at kontrollere gyldigheden af et radio button-felt. Den returnerer true, hvis mindst én radio button er markeret, og false, hvis ingen radio buttons er valgt.
- setCustomValidity() – Denne metode kan bruges til at tilpasse en fejlmeddelelse, der vises, når formularen ikke er gyldig.
Konklusion
HTML DOM Input Radio required Property er en nyttig egenskab til at validere radio buttons i HTML-formularer. Ved at gøre feltet obligatorisk sikrer du, at brugerne ikke overser dette felt og sender formularen uden at vælge en passende option. Vi har udforsket, hvordan man implementerer denne egenskab i HTML-koden og bruger de tilgængelige DOM-metoder til at håndtere validering og tilpassede fejlmeddelelser.
Husk at bruge denne egenskab i dine formularer, hvor det er relevant, for at sikre en bedre brugeroplevelse og en mere præcis dataindsamling.
Ofte stillede spørgsmål
Hvad er HTML DOM Input Radio required Property i HTML?
Hvordan implementerer man HTML DOM Input Radio required Property i et HTML-skema?
Hvad sker der, hvis man ikke angiver HTML DOM Input Radio required Property i en radioknap?
Kan man have flere HTML DOM Input Radio required Property i samme formular?
Hvilke attributter kan man også tilføje til HTML DOM Input Radio required Property?
Kan man tilføje egne valideringsregler til HTML DOM Input Radio required Property?
Hvordan kan man style en radioknap med HTML DOM Input Radio required Property?
Kan man tilføje en standardvalgt mulighed til en radioknap med HTML DOM Input Radio required Property?
Kan man tilføje tekst eller billeder til en radioknap med HTML DOM Input Radio required Property?
Hvad er forskellen mellem HTML DOM Input Radio required Property og HTML DOM Input Checkbox required Property?
Andre populære artikler: VBScript IsDate Funktion • Introduktion • HTML DOM NodeList length Property • HTML DOM Input Number placeholder Property • VBScript StrComp Function • C-Functions Recursions • Pandas DataFrame notnull() Metode • CSS hsla() funktion • HTML a rel-attribut – En dybdegående guide • Django if-tag: En dybdegående guide • AWS Networking Basics • PHP substr_compare() Funktion • CSS ::placeholder Selector • Dybdegående artikel om XSLT